"The Gift"
In pairs you will "offer" your partner a gift through silence and mime and they will accept it verbally and physically. Then they will offer you one as well.
Partner A: (holding hands very wide and miming something heavy) Here Johnny! I have something for you.
Partner B: (taking hold of the object as close to same physicality as Partner A) Wow, Thanks, Jane-- I have been waiting for my own fireproof safe for a long time. (then Partner B-- hands something to Partner A-- perhaps a tiny little fragile thing that fits in their palm) Here Johnny, I have something for you.
Partner A: (taking hold of the imaginary tiny thing) Wow, Thanks Johnny. I have always wanted my very own Robin's egg. AND SO ON.
